What is the treatment for Baby Blues?

Health
1 answer:
ollegr [7]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

If your talking about Baby Blues that occurs after pregnancy hears some answers-

1. Talk with someone that you trust about how you are feeling.

2. Keep a healthy diet.

3. Get outside to enjoy fresh air.

4. Don’t expect perfection in the first few weeks. Give yourself time to heal from birth, to adjust to your new “job,” and for feeding and sleeping routines to settle in.Ask for help–help with meals, other children, getting into a “routine”, or any help that allows you to focus on the joy of having a new baby and not just the pressure of juggling it all.

5. Learn to ask for help, its okay to ask others with, cooking, cleaning, and your children.

How do warzones and natural disasters become breeding grounds for infectious diseases?
balandron [24]

Answer:

In these situations, the nonavailability of safe water and sanitation facillities, more crowded areas of living, underlying health issues within the population and not being able to access as easily medical help can be a major factor in illness spreading more rapidly, along with any old water or mold and in extreme cases dead bodies that sit can cause more bacteria to grow and spread.
